MTV Rodney Heals

MTV launched a weird and wonderful advertising campaign in 2007, the story of Rodney Gray, an air guitarist now air massage cult leader. The Rodney Heals campaign was developed to brand MTV Spirit around the world. Rodney Gray, played by Tim Raby, has grown around him a group of followers who passionately believe in the power of whale music, air massage and motivational talks. The campaign includes several videos: Rodney’s Rock Background, Elise, Fertility Treatment, Power of Words, Rodney Knows Things, Whale Song, When Whales Sing.

Rodney Heals Credits

The Rodney Heals campaign was developed at Exile Films, New Zealand by media creative strategist / PR coordinator Ilya Rozhdestvensky, writer/director Gaysorn Thavat (now at Robber’s Dog), interactive creative directors Kentaro Yamada and Christian Schneider, and executive producer Ian Gibbons.

Thavat built an entire Rodney cult, complete with poignant scriptural quotes and spiritual rites. “MTV is a cult, it’s a network as the spirit of youth. In a way creating a character like Rodney created a self-perpetuating campaign, which religion is,” she says.

Thavat’s direction helped actor Tim Raby develop a ‘deep and sensitive’ character, with bad hair and an excruciating wardrobe of spandex pants and kaftans. Although filmed in West Auckland, New Zealand, the characters, judging by their MySpace profiles, are meant to be British.
